Wages, Hours, Leave, and Workplace Safety in Santa Ana
Compensation disputes can create immediate financial pressure for employees
Understanding Pay and Working Hour Problems
A Santa Ana Wage & Hour Disputes Lawyer can help an employee evaluate concerns involving wages, overtime, working time, meal periods, rest periods, deductions, or other compensation issues
| Possible Concern | What May Need Review |
|---|---|
| Overtime compensation | Time records, pay statements, and applicable classification |
| Regular compensation | Pay records and hours worked |
| Break-related issues | Employer practices and records |
| Improper deductions | Pay statements and reason for deductions |

Why the Full Employment Timeline Matters
Useful documentation can include emails, text messages, pay statements, schedules, policies, performance reviews, written complaints, and notices concerning employment decisions
